WebJan 12, 2024 · Traditional Chinese peanut cookies only require 4 simple ingredients: Peanuts: Frying then blending your own peanuts tastes the best but that can be a palaver. If you don't have time, an easier way is to buy peanut powder then dry fry it to make it more fragrant. Remember to blend finely, if not the cookies will crumble. Kung Pao Tofu (Vegan/Vegetarian) WebAug 5, 2014 · Step 2: Add in seasonings & water. Step 3: Weigh down the peanuts. Raw peanuts float to the top of the water, so to make sure that they cook evenly, I like to add a plate into the pot to submerge the peanuts. Step 4: Cook. I am using a pressure cooker (60 minutes under high pressure), but you can use a slow cooker (high for 6-8 hours) or boil ...
